Hebron, PA vs Modena, PA
Hebron, PA and Modena, PA have a very similar cost of living, with only a 4.8% difference in their overall index. Hebron scores 87 while Modena scores 92 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Hebron are $165,900 compared to $175,000 in Modena, a 5% gap.
Median household income in Hebron is $99,605 compared to $80,938 in Modena (+23.1%). Hebron off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power.
